我正在测试Postgres插入性能。我有一个表,其中有一列,其数据类型为数字。还有一个索引。我用这个查询填充了数据库:我非常快地插入了400万行,使用上面的查询一次插入10,000行。在数据库达到60

我需要通过编程的方式将数千万条记录插入Postgres数据库。目前,我在一个查询中执行了数千条插入语句。有没有更好的方法来做到这一点,一些我不知道的批量插入语句?

如果我一次插入多行,数据库查询是否更快:like(我需要插入2-3000行)

我正在寻找一种很好的方法来执行多行插入到Oracle 9数据库。以下内容在MySQL中有效,但在Oracle中似乎不受支持。

插入带有撇号的值的正确SQL语法是什么?我一直得到一个错误,因为我认为O后面的撇号是值的结束标记。

我使用Python写postgres数据库:但由于我的一些行是相同的,我得到以下错误:我怎么能写一个'插入,除非这行已经存在' SQL语句?我见过这样的复杂语句:但首先,这对我需要的东西来说是不是太过

我从谷歌搜索开始,找到了如何在标准SQL中写INSERT如果不存在查询,其中讨论了互斥表。我有一个包含1400万条记录的表。如果我想以相同的格式添加更多的数据,是否有一种方法可以确保我想要插入的记录不